This hotel is pure kitsch! Allegedly designed by a Yemeni prince, the exterior owes
much to Disney, while its stained-glass and marble interior is a cross between art deco and
a royal Bedouin tent. With luxurious, balconied rooms, Muscat's best Italian restaurant,
Tuscany, water sports and limitless walks along the sandy beach, this hotel has more than
one angle.

In a
secluded bay ringed by spectacular mountains, Al-Bustan is more palace than hotel. It has
an atmosphere and class of its own, partly engendered through the Arabian-style interior
and top-quality restaurants. The hotel grounds are like a Garden of Eden with infinity
pools and shady lawns backing onto a pristine beach. A Six Senses Spa is due to open in
late 2013.
Eating
There are lots of opportunities for fine dining in Muscat, particularly at top-end hotels.
Equally, it's hard to go 10 paces without tripping over a stand selling
shwarma
(meat
sliced off the spit and stuffed in pita-type bread with chopped tomatoes and garnish).
Dozens of what are locally termed 'coffee-shops' abound in Muscat selling a variety of
largely Indian snacks, such as omelettes rolled up in Arabic bread with chilli, samosas and
curried potatoes. It is more difficult to eat typical Omani food - the best options are Ubar,
Khargeen and Bin Ateeq. For a comprehensive round-up of Muscat's restaurants and
cafés, it's worth buying a copy of
Time Out Muscat
(OR2). Following is a selection of res-
taurants that give a flavour of the region, either in menu or venue, and some of Muscat's
favourite cafes.
